The mitre decides everything
A frame corner is two 45 degree cuts meeting. If each is out by a quarter of a degree, the corner shows a visible wedge of light, and no amount of clamping or filling hides it because the moulding profile no longer lines up either.
That is why picture framers use a mitre trimmer or a dedicated saw rather than a general mitre saw. A trimmer shears the timber with a guillotine blade against a fixed 45 degree fence, and it produces a face smooth enough to glue directly and an angle that does not drift with the blade.
- A quarter of a degree shows
- Multiplied over four corners it is a visible gap. This is the whole reason for specialist tools.
- Trimmer over saw
- A guillotine shear against a fixed fence, giving a glue ready face and an angle that cannot drift.
- Cut both halves of a pair together
- Opposite sides identical matters more than either being exactly right.
- Check with a set square
- Two offcuts held together should make a perfect right angle. It takes seconds and it is conclusive.
Joining the corners
A glued mitre alone is weak, because it is end grain to end grain. It needs mechanical reinforcement, and the standard is a wedge, or V nail, driven up into the joint from underneath by an underpinner. The wedge pulls the two faces together as it goes in.
For occasional work, corner clamps and glue with panel pins driven from the outside will hold, and the pin holes then need filling. An underpinner leaves nothing visible on the face, which is why every frame shop has one.
- Glue alone is not enough
- End grain to end grain is a weak joint. It needs a wedge, a pin or a spline.
- Underpinner wedges pull it closed
- Driven from below, so nothing shows on the face and the joint tightens as they go in.
- Two wedges per corner
- One near the inside edge and one near the outside, so the corner cannot rotate.
- Clamp and pin for occasional work
- Corner clamps, glue and panel pins from outside. The holes then need filling.
Cutting mounts and bevels
A window mount is cut with a bevelled edge so the aperture opens outward toward the picture, which is what gives the depth. That bevel is cut by a mount cutter running a blade at 45 degrees along a guide, not by a knife freehand.
The classic mistake is equal borders all round. A mount traditionally has a slightly deeper bottom border, because the eye reads a visually centred aperture as slightly high. Around 10 to 15 percent more at the bottom is the usual allowance.
- Bevel opens outward
- Toward the picture, which is what gives the aperture its depth and shadow line.
- Deeper bottom border
- About 10 to 15 percent more. A geometrically centred aperture reads as too high.
- Cut on the back
- So the blade enters from the reverse and any slight overrun is on the hidden face.
- Fresh blade every few mounts
- A dull blade drags and tears the core, which shows as a fuzzy bevel edge.
Glass, acrylic and what goes behind
Glass is cut by scoring once with a wheel and snapping along the score. Once is the rule: running the cutter back over a score never improves it and it ruins the wheel. Acrylic is cut by scoring repeatedly or with a fine saw, and it scratches far more easily than glass.
Behind the picture goes a backing board, then it is all held in with flexible points or a points driver, and the back is sealed with tape. The sealing matters more than people expect, since dust and insects get in through an unsealed rebate and cannot be removed later.
- Score once, then snap
- Rerunning a score never helps and it destroys the cutter wheel. One firm pass.
- Acrylic scratches
- Leave the film on until the last moment, and never clean it with a paper towel.
- Points, not nails
- Flexible points hold the stack in and can be lifted later to reopen the frame without damage.
- Seal the back
- Tape around the rebate. Dust and insects enter through an unsealed back and cannot be got out.
If the picture matters
Ordinary mount board and tape are acidic, and over years they burn a brown line into the edge of a print where they touch it. That damage is not reversible. For anything of value, conservation grade board and acid free tape are the difference between framing and slowly destroying.
The same applies to the mounting method. Never dry mount, glue or tape a print down permanently if it might ever need to come out. Hinge it at the top with acid free tape so it hangs free and can be removed.
- Acidic board burns the print
- A brown line at the mount edge within a few years, and it does not come back out.
- Conservation board and acid free tape
- For anything you would be sorry to damage. The cost difference is small.
- Hinge, never glue down
- Acid free tape at the top only, so the print hangs free and can be removed later.
- Keep the picture off the glass
- A mount or a spacer, because condensation makes a print stick to glass permanently.
Frequently asked questions
- What tools do I need to start picture framing?
- A mitre trimmer or fine mitre saw, an underpinner or corner clamps, a mount cutter, a glass cutter, a points driver, a steel rule and set square, glue, and a soft mallet. That set will produce a properly made frame with a closed corner and a bevelled mount.
- Why does my frame corner have a gap?
- Because the two mitres are not exactly 45 degrees. Even a quarter of a degree out on each shows as a visible wedge, and it multiplies across four corners. Check by holding two offcuts together against a set square, and use a trimmer rather than a general mitre saw.
- What is an underpinner?
- A machine that drives a wedge shaped V nail up into a mitre joint from underneath. The wedge pulls the two faces together as it enters and leaves nothing visible on the front of the frame, which is why it is the standard way to join a picture frame.
- What is a mitre trimmer and why not use a mitre saw?
- A trimmer shears the moulding with a guillotine blade against a fixed 45 degree fence. It gives a face smooth enough to glue straight away and an angle that cannot drift as a saw blade can. A mitre saw leaves saw marks and its accuracy depends on the blade and the setup.
- How do I cut a bevelled mount?
- With a mount cutter, which runs a blade at 45 degrees along a guide bar with adjustable stops. Cut from the back so the blade enters the reverse face, and change the blade every few mounts because a dull one drags and leaves a fuzzy bevel.
- Should mount borders be equal all round?
- Traditionally not. The bottom border is made about 10 to 15 percent deeper, because the eye reads a geometrically centred aperture as sitting slightly high. Equal borders look correct on a measurement and slightly wrong on the wall.
- How do I cut picture glass?
- Score once with a glass cutter along a straightedge, then snap along the score by lifting or tapping from underneath. Never run the cutter back over a score, since it does not improve the cut and it ruins the wheel. Wear gloves and eye protection.
- Does it matter what mount board I use?
- For anything of value, yes. Ordinary board and tape are acidic and burn a brown line into the edge of a print over a few years, which is not reversible. Conservation grade board and acid free tape cost a little more and prevent it entirely.
